Operational Risk Motivation

By increasing colleague awareness and responsibility for Operational Risk, we hopefully raise motivation levels, especially when effort is rewarded.
Colleagues will always perform better when they see a reward at the end of the tunnel. Right now that tunnel is long and dark. Whilst everyone is cutting costs, it is important to retain reliable and conscientious staff. Reward can take many forms, "thank you" sometimes isn't enough, as being appreciated for going the extra mile means more. e.g. "thank you" from the top boss, a longer lunch hour, bacon rolls at the team meeting each week.............it doesn't have to cost a lot, but effort should be recognised.
